  • Watergate Tapes - The Microphones No One Was Supposed to Know About
    Apr 14 2026
    Maxwell Slate examines Nixon's secret White House recording system—how it was installed, who knew about it, and how Alexander Butterfield's 1973 testimony exposed 4,000 hours of damning evidence that ultimately brought down a presidency and forever changed executive accountability.
